Streaming is revolutionizing the video and TV industries. In this podcast, two industry veterans, Will Richmond, Editor, and Publisher of VideoNuze, and Colin Dixon, Founder and Chief Analyst of nScreenMedia give listeners their insiders’ take on the most important streaming news and events. They also interview industry leaders who are shaping the business of streaming video.

Disney+ added nearly 12 million subscribers in the recent holiday quarter, an encouraging sign that the Disney+, Hulu, and ESPN+ bundle is well accepted. But bundling also brings with it challenges in counting subscribers.

YouTube continues to rule the AVOD world, posting revenue of $29 billion in 2021. And Roku continues to dominate US connected TV, driving more streaming minutes than its top-four rivals combined.
